With the rapid development of modern printing and publishing,
BIGC has experienced remarkable changes. It started from the Department
of Printing in Culture Institute affiliated to the Ministry of Culture
in 1958and laid the foundation of China’s higher education in printing.
In 1961, Culture Institute was cancelled and its Department of Printing
was merged into Central Academy of Art and Design. The Department of
Printing shouldered the burden of printing talents development and
cultural inheritance of Chinese civilization and continued to grow up.
In 1978, BIGC was founded on the base of Central Academy of Art and
Design with the permission of the State Council,. Under the leadership
of China’s Press Administration, through constant expansion and
connotative promotion, it grew into an undergraduate college which
specialized in developing high-level professionals of printing and
publishing.
With the ripening and improvement of undergraduate
educational system, BIGC accumulates rich experience and gains great
advantage in its characteristic higher education. Quality of talent
development and social influence has been on the rise. In 1998, with the
approval of the Academic Degrees Committee of State Council, BIGC
acquired the conferring right of master’s degree and started the
postgraduate education, till then the subject construction of BIGC
entered a new phase of development. After the national adjustment of
higher education institution in 2000, BIGC became a university under the
joint jurisdiction of General Administration of Press and
Publishing(GAPP)and Beijing Municipality, with the latter as its main
supervisor, which further enhanced the ability of educational resource
allocation, and service scope for profession and development capital
social and economic development widened a lot.
